JOB SUMMARY

The Senior Project Manager is required to manage projects from beginning to finish.  This includes working with stakeholders to ensure project objectives are met.  This includes creation of budgets and timelines. 
The Senior Project Manager must have excellent time management skills, excellent communication skills and ability to utilize project management software.  This position will also work directly with finance department to ensure invoices for projects are paid accurately and promptly.  This position will also manage the process of handing the completed project to owners including Facilities Management. 

The specific job functions include but are not limited 

  • Create  RFP (Request for Proposal) documents  and assemble interview panels for prospective Architectural, Engineering and Construction firms.  This includes decision matrix for interview group and scheduling of interviews. 
  • Works with UVACH legal to create contracts for engagement of Architectural, Engineering and Construction firms. 
  • Acts as mentor for Project Managers. 
  • Creates, prepares and monitors comprehensive budgets for projects.
  • Create comprehensive schedules and manage all aspects of project to the schedule.
  • Manage all aspects of projects, including paying vendors, overseeing ordering of equipment and furniture.
  • Conduct OAC meetings on a regularly scheduled meeting.
  • Maintain information in project management software.
  • Ensure compliance to all regulatory guidelines, to include OSHA, Joint Commission, CMMS, FGI and relevant local authorities. 
  • Conduct project closeout meetings with Facilities Department to ensure smooth transition
